| | | | GREEK LEMON-RICE SOUP | | |
3 c. chicken broth 2 to 3 oz. uncooked regular rice 2 eggs 3 tbsp. lemon juice Dash of salt Dash of white pepper In 2-quart saucepan, bring broth to a boil. Reduce heat, add rice, cover and simmer until rice is tender, about 20 minutes. In small bowl, beat eggs and lemon juice. Stirring constantly, add 1 cup of hot soup, a little at a time. Stir mixture into soup in pan and heat. Do not boil! Season with salt and pepper. Serve immediately. Serves 4. NOTE: 2 oz. rice makes thinner soup; 3 oz. rice makes thick soup. Weight instead of measurement gives the option of using medium grain rice. |
